Violet's Story

Violet is a now ~ 5 month old mixed breed puppy rescued in a rural Kentucky shelter. She was lucky enough to be saved and hitch a ride north. She is a sweet, happy, and healthy puppy. She weighs about 20# and is expected to be a medium sized dog. She is an active young pup who is great with other dogs and cats. She would make a great hiking and running buddy. She does well in a crate, is house-trained, and leash-trained. She is smart and fun to train; she already knows sit, stay, and wait.<br/><br/>She is vaccinated, dewormed, is on prevention, and will be spayed in the next few weeks at the rescue vet.
